I know for a custom puppet I worked on I wound up making the dress. I looked at patterns at Wal Mart to determine basically how it should go together and the shapes that were common to what I was looking for. I used scraps for the prototype and the shiny good stuff for the final project.

It worked pretty well. Other than that kids clothing like ravage said. I usually get 18mo-3T depending on the puppet. I've been told not to overlook places like Goodwill. They have some gently preowned clothing at bargan prices.
